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2619 164246956 532
2163 97 84905
2163 97 84905
6159583 561305834 980 2718443
All about undefined
Interested in learning more?
2163 97 84905
6159583 561305834 980 2718443
See more
4702 3020578 88829186
5488341 0982 587207879
See more
37 800717919
45127 287 888 5302
See more